Kremna is a village located in the city of Užice, southwestern Serbia. As of 2022 census, the village had a population of 452 inhabitants. Kremna is well known for the prophets Miloš Tarabić and his nephew, Mitar Tarabić. Kremna is situated 7 km southeast of Станкова чесма.
